He was born in Alexandria, West Dunbartonshire, Scotland.
==Playing career== Mills was signed by Aberdeen from Junior club Bridgeton Waverley in 1932.<ref name = "afc">{{cite news|url=http://www.afc.co.uk/articles/20070213/willie-mills_2212041_980517|title=Willie Mills |work=afc.co.uk |publisher=Aberdeen FC |date=13 February 2007 |accessdate=9 September 2012}}</ref> He entered their first team almost immediately, aged 17.<ref name = "afc"/> Mills was primarily a creative player, but also scored frequently and was the club's top goalscorer in the 1933–34 season.<ref name = "afc"/>
He was transferred to Huddersfield Town in March 1938 for £6,500.<ref name = "afc"/> Mills did not stay long in English football, however, as the Second World War curtailed league play.<ref name = "afc"/> After the war concluded he played in the Highland Football League for Lossiemouth and Huntly.<ref name = "afc"/>
==International== Mills represented Scotland three times between October 1935 and December 1936.<ref name = "afc"/><ref>{{cite web |url= http://www.londonhearts.com/scotland/players/williammills.html |title = William Mills |work = londonhearts.com | publisher= London Hearts Supporters' Club |accessdate= 9 September 2012}}</ref><ref name = SFA/>
==Personal life== His brother Hugh 'Bunty' Mills was also a footballer, who began his career at Bridgeton and featured for West Ham.<ref name = "whu">{{cite web|url=http://www.westhamstats.info/westham.php?west=2&ham=468&united=Hugh_Mills|title=Hugh Mills |publisher=West Ham Utd Statistics |accessdate=29 April 2017}}</ref>
